The Lithuania women's national 3x3 basketball team is the basketball side that represents Lithuania in international 3x3 basketball (3 against 3) competitions. It is organized and run by the Lithuanian Basketball Federation.[1]
World Cup record
Year | Position | Pld | W | L |
---|---|---|---|---|
2012 Athens | Did not qualify | |||
2014 Moscow | ||||
2016 Guangzhou | ||||
2017 Nantes | ||||
2018 Bocaue | ||||
2019 Amsterdam | ||||
2022 Antwerp | 4th | 8 | 5 | 3 |
2023 Vienna | 15th | 4 | 1 | 3 |
Total | 2/8 | 12 | 6 | 6 |
